Transaction 56e804c52454cdf8eb66e6e477a1e412c90748d5c422e82453b45b276bff93d8
1 Input
2 Outputs
- 56e804c52454cdf8eb66e6e477a1e412c90748d5c422e82453b45b276bff93d8:0
- 56e804c52454cdf8eb66e6e477a1e412c90748d5c422e82453b45b276bff93d8:1
value 44765387
address 14j5dZMDPA7AvA2pheYz41cn54W6qi4Pxw
value 499112040
address 13JHhGx5m7Cdbdabm6o7yMeuD77g85bFGS